课程章节介绍
今天我们来聊聊Salesforce中的交叉过滤器。这个功能非常有用,尤其是在你需要通过相关记录来筛选主记录的时候。
首先,什么是交叉过滤器呢?简单来说,交叉过滤器允许你通过查看与主记录相关的子记录来筛选主记录。比如说,你有一个“职位”对象,每个职位可能有多个“工作申请”。如果你想查看所有有至少一个开放工作申请的职位,你就可以使用交叉过滤器来实现。
交叉过滤器有两种类型:有条件和无条件。有条件的意思是,你设置了一些特定的条件来筛选子记录。无条件则是没有特定条件,只要存在相关的子记录就行。
举个例子,假设你有一个“职位”报表,你想筛选出所有有开放工作申请的职位。你可以设置一个交叉过滤器,条件是“工作申请”状态为“开放”。这样,报表就只会显示那些有至少一个开放工作申请的职位。
另外,Salesforce对交叉过滤器有一些限制。每个报表最多可以设置3个交叉过滤器,而每个交叉过滤器最多可以有5个子过滤器。所以,在设计报表时,要合理使用这些过滤器,确保它们能帮助你得到最准确的数据。
总结一下,交叉过滤器是一个非常强大的工具,可以帮助你通过相关记录来筛选主记录。记住,每个报表最多3个交叉过滤器,每个过滤器最多5个子过滤器。希望这个解释对你有帮助!